Dewiper the rear like I did! Easy enough to do. 2 (maybe 3+) screws holdin boot lining on. undo them, then pull. pull hard! I fell over lol.

Then a spanner to undo bolt on arm. Should pull out. May need force. I used a hammer to tap it through lol

Make sure you disconnect the pipe in the engine bay so you don't accidently squirt water in the boot lid ;)
